Advertisement

Golang Template Struct

Golang Template Struct - A template engine or template processor is a library designed to. Golang has two packages with templates: Struct fields to be used in templates should be exported (started with capital letter). Templates fields are evaluated relative to the current context {{.}}. This trend has been fueled by tools like. Template in golang is a robust feature to create dynamic content or show customized output to the user. The following evaluates the template using a map containing whois as key, and res as the value: Templates are a common view through which we can pass. Given a collection of structs, how can i use the range template iterator to print out a table that assigns a row per struct, and a column per field value without explicity naming the fields? We use go version 1.22.2.

Struct fields to be used in templates should be exported (started with capital letter). We can create a new template and parse its body from a string. The text/template package implements templates for generating text output, while the. Templates fields are evaluated relative to the current context {{.}}. Template in golang is a robust feature to create dynamic content or show customized output to the user. In this article we show how to create templates in golang with standard library. Golang has two packages with templates: The go template engine has actions dedicated to iteration. In this post, we will see templates and their usages in the go programming language. Go templates can print data.

Golang Template Function
Golang Tutorial 20 Structs and Custom Types
GoLang Tutorial Structs and receiver methods 2020
Golang Template Assign Variable at Miguel Gama blog
Golang Structs Example Structs In Go Explained
Golang Array of Structs Delft Stack
What Are Structs in Golang?
Ultimate Handbook to Golang Structs
GoLang Tutorial Structs and receiver methods 2020
GoLang Tutorial Structs and receiver methods 2020

I Have The Following Code And Would Like To Iterate Though The Themes In A Template, But For The Life Of Me I Can't Seem To Get Past The Fact It Is A Nested Container.

This trend has been fueled by tools like. Tmpl, err := template.new(letter).parse(letter) if err != nil { fmt.println(err.error()) harry := person{ firstname: Template in golang is a robust feature to create dynamic content or show customized output to the user. The text/template package implements templates for generating text output, while the.

Templates Are A Mix Of Static Text And “Actions” Enclosed In {{.}} That Are Used To Dynamically Insert Content.

In this post, we will see templates and their usages in the go programming language. Struct fields to be used in templates should be exported (started with capital letter). We can create a new template and parse its body from a string. For instance, let’s add the property shippingoptions to our product type struct (the data that we will pass to the template) :

In This Guide, We Will Explore How To Use The Html/Template Package In Go, Covering Everything From Basic Template Syntax To Advanced Features And Best Practices.

We use go version 1.22.2. Go templates can print data. Golang templates cheatsheet the go standard library provides a set of packages to generate output. For example, one can print struct field or map value.

In This Article We Show How To Create Templates In Golang With Standard Library.

Templates are a common view through which we can pass. The following evaluates the template using a map containing whois as key, and res as the value: Templates fields are evaluated relative to the current context {{.}}. The go template engine has actions dedicated to iteration.

Related Post: